Re: The Luftwaffe Over Germany: The Defense of the Reich
The Luftwaffe over Germany is a good study, but it doesn't cover the events on a detailed day to day basis.
The book is well written and covers all phases of the day war over the Reich, and it does so through many detailed operations. It also provides a solid base, by explaining the command structure etc. That said it is probably the most detailed single volume study available. It does not include the air battle during the night. Although I don't share all the conclusions, I think it is a must have book for any (serious) enthusiast or student of the Luftwaffe.
